Why Buying Parrots is Prohibited

1. Conservation Concerns

One of the main reasons for prohibiting the sale of parrots is the disconcerting decrease in their populations. Numerous parrot types are threatened or threatened due to:

  • Habitat Destruction: Deforestation for agriculture and city development has actually destroyed large areas of natural habitats.
  • Unlawful Pet Trade: The capture and sale of wild parrots for the family pet trade have actually caused substantial population declines.

The following table details some of the most endangered parrot types and their IUCN (International Union for Conservation of Nature) status:

Parrot SpeciesIUCN StatusPopulation EstimatePrimary Threats
Spix's MacawCritically EndangeredPossibly extinct in the wildHabitat loss, illegal trade
KakapoSeriously EndangeredApproximately 250Predation by presented species
Blue-throated MacawEndangered300-500Habitat destruction, prohibited trapping
Yellow-eared ParrotEndangered250-500Environment loss, farming
Red-vented CockatooEndangeredUnidentifiedLogging, trapping

3. Legal Regulations

Lots of nations have acknowledged the plight of parrots and have enacted laws to protect them. The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species of Wild Fauna and Flora (CITES) has positioned constraints on global trade to secure vulnerable species. Furthermore, individual countries, Preis FüR Graupapageien such as the United States, have actually likewise established policies like the Wild Bird Conservation Act (WBCA) to minimize the impact of the family pet trade on bird populations.
